How do you find the length of rectangle or square if the area and width are known?

For a rectangle or square, Area = Length * Width So Length = Area / Width.

How do you find the length of a rectangle when the width and area are provided?

For a rectangle, area equals length times width. To find the length given the width and area, divide the area by the width.
